Bnard uf Educatinn MR. BROOKS PARSONS Superintendent of Schools SCHOOL BOARDeMr. Funk, Dr. Gabe, Mn Ramage, Mr. Parsons, Superintendent; Mr. Vogel, Mr. Evans, Mr. Leary, Clerk. One of the IittIe-heard-of forces behind Norwood High School is the Board of Education. The Board has the job of planning each year with the future in mind; They must naturally be a group of men who are alert enough to keep pace with each new method in the field of education. Some of their various jobs are budgeting the finances of the public schools and acting as an ad- visory board to the superintendent. They have planned several physical changes in the school next year. Uninterested city residents must be made inter ested in our schools 50 that they will vote to support the Boarch fmancial recommendations. To be con- vincing in that capacity, their concern must be genuine. The consistently high standards and ranking of Norwood High School seem to say, The Board of Education is behind you, young people?

Administratiun Mr. Albert Geselbracht heads the Administration of Norwood High School. It is his duty to advise the Student Council and to see that the school is run properly. As the Dean of Girls, Miss GriHin works hard as the head of the Miami Extension and as advisot for GirIsh Council. She helps the girls solve their prob- lems and helps the seniors plan for the future. Acting in the capacity of Dean of Boys, Mr. San- derson counsels the boys, advises the Junior Class, and heads the summer school program. Mr. Kistler, who serves as assistant principal, directs the Technical School and Night School. These four key people are always working to see that Norwood High School is run as smoothly as possible.
